/en/
en
true
3337
1733
44258
87
107
Palma
1140
6081
palma
Palma
194
39.577611
158
4052
2.65045
30
12
212
true
1,3,8
88
2349
40100
0
1102447
Map
Street ViewExplore
AddressRonda de Migjorn